**Transporting Permit Blueprints — Quick Guide.** The rolled blueprints for the Harlowe Quay permit application travel in the grey tube marked PLN-4. Keep the tube capped and dry; the municipal office at Verdun Cross rejects creased sheets. Log the tube out of the plan room before loading. The courier hand-over instruction appears directly below this line.

courier memo of yawep-yafog: the pramir ulaix courier leaves the ulavan aldix frair zorok oliiel joreth rusdor fenvan ledger at gate 1305 under passcode 514738

**Q: The Norvane partner SFTP drop stopped accepting uploads. What do I do?**

First check that the chroot volume on the Teldrift relay isn't full; partners often retry aggressively and fill it overnight. If the host key was rotated during last week's maintenance, you must re-seal the transfer vault before restarting the daemon. Unsealing requires the recovery passphrase below.

strongbox words: zorwyn-sorael-belion-ulaius-silmir-ulays-briax-rusdor-gorix

## Onboarding: GateTally Turnstile Counter

GateTally aggregates turnstile clicks from stadium gates into per-minute counts. Plugins receive batched events via the `ingest` hook; do not assume ordering. Counts are idempotent on `(gate_id, minute)`, so retries are safe. Test against the sandbox arena dataset before requesting production access. Your plugin connects to the sandbox counts database with the string below.

primary connection of tajeg-tajop = postgresql://julax_svc:DI@db-e7f3.kelvidyn.corp:5432/rusdor

## Export memory usage — onboarding notes

The Gridloom spreadsheet exporter streams rows to avoid loading full workbooks into memory, but wide sheets with heavy formula columns can still spike the worker past 2 GB. We cap exports at 400k cells and shunt anything larger to the batch queue. Memory metrics go to the Ferrowatch dashboard, which you'll want access to in week one. The dashboard's ingest agent authenticates with a service key, shown here for reference:

service key, yadug-bajog: zpat3_pou